  9. Hi All, I got a G4+ ttlink pnp on my Audi A4. I've wired a 150psi fuel pressure sensor to AN Volt 2 and assigned a calibration table and it is reading 155psi. Whilst unplugged I have 5v across the ground and 5v in and 0v across signal and ground. When I plug it in and back probe I'm getting 4.6v across signal and ground. I tested the same with a spare sensor and I'm getting the same result. Any idea as to what I'm doing wrong or could be the issue? I've also got an AEM x series 150psi oil pressure gauge wired in to AN Volt 7 and this too is not reading correctly via the gauge and pclink, it just reads 11psi on gauge and 13.8psi on pclink. The instructions says white wire to analog input on ecu (AN volt 7?) and the BROWN wire must be connected to the negative of the analog input of the logging device orECU. If the logging device or ECU does not have a differential analog input (both a dedicated positive and negative terminal for the analog input) then connect the BROWN wire to the shared signal ground. If the device doesnot have a dedicated signal ground then as a last course ofaction, connect it to the power ground of the logging device. I connected it to the power ground, could this be the issue?
